Home
last modified time | relevance | path

Searched refs:mBuffer (Results 1 – 17 of 17) sorted by relevance

/openthread-latest/src/lib/spinel/
Dmulti_frame_buffer.hpp136 mWritePointer = mBuffer; in Clear()
137 mRemainingLength = sizeof(mBuffer); in Clear()
146 bool IsEmpty(void) const { return (mWritePointer == mBuffer); } in IsEmpty()
153 uint16_t GetLength(void) const { return static_cast<uint16_t>(mWritePointer - mBuffer); } in GetLength()
160 uint8_t *GetFrame(void) { return mBuffer; } in GetFrame()
163 uint8_t mBuffer[kSize]; member in ot::Spinel::FrameBuffer
193 mWriteFrameStart = mBuffer; in Clear()
194 mWritePointer = mBuffer + kHeaderSize; in Clear()
220 if (GetFrame() + aLength <= GetArrayEnd(mBuffer)) in SetLength()
223 mRemainingLength = static_cast<uint16_t>(mBuffer + kSize - mWritePointer); in SetLength()
[all …]
Dspi_frame.hpp142 : mBuffer(aBuffer) in SpiFrame()
151 uint8_t *GetData(void) { return mBuffer + kHeaderSize; } in GetData()
160 …bool IsValid(void) const { return ((mBuffer[kIndexFlagByte] & kFlagPatternMask) == kFlagPattern); } in IsValid()
167 … bool IsResetFlagSet(void) const { return ((mBuffer[kIndexFlagByte] & kFlagReset) == kFlagReset); } in IsResetFlagSet()
174 …void SetHeaderFlagByte(bool aResetFlag) { mBuffer[kIndexFlagByte] = kFlagPattern | (aResetFlag ? k… in SetHeaderFlagByte()
181 uint8_t GetHeaderFlagByte(void) const { return mBuffer[kIndexFlagByte]; } in GetHeaderFlagByte()
192 Lib::Utils::LittleEndian::WriteUint16(aAcceptLen, mBuffer + kIndexAcceptLen); in SetHeaderAcceptLen()
200 …uint16_t GetHeaderAcceptLen(void) const { return Lib::Utils::LittleEndian::ReadUint16(mBuffer + kI… in GetHeaderAcceptLen()
211 Lib::Utils::LittleEndian::WriteUint16(aDataLen, mBuffer + kIndexDataLen); in SetHeaderDataLen()
219 …uint16_t GetHeaderDataLen(void) const { return Lib::Utils::LittleEndian::ReadUint16(mBuffer + kInd… in GetHeaderDataLen()
[all …]
Dspinel_buffer.cpp45 : mBuffer(aBuffer) in Buffer()
70 mWriteFrameStart[kPriorityLow] = mBuffer; in Clear()
71 mWriteFrameStart[kPriorityHigh] = GetUpdatedBufPtr(mBuffer, 1, kBackward); in Clear()
73 mWriteSegmentHead = mBuffer; in Clear()
74 mWriteSegmentTail = mBuffer; in Clear()
82 mReadFrameStart[kPriorityLow] = mBuffer; in Clear()
83 mReadFrameStart[kPriorityHigh] = GetUpdatedBufPtr(mBuffer, 1, kBackward); in Clear()
84 mReadSegmentHead = mBuffer; in Clear()
85 mReadSegmentTail = mBuffer; in Clear()
86 mReadPointer = mBuffer; in Clear()
[all …]
Dspinel_buffer.hpp593 uint8_t *const mBuffer; // Pointer to the buffer used to store the data. member in ot::Spinel::Buffer
/openthread-latest/src/core/common/
Dframe_builder.cpp50 mBuffer = static_cast<uint8_t *>(aBuffer); in Init()
76 memcpy(mBuffer + mLength, aBuffer, aLength); in AppendBytes()
98 aMacAddress.GetExtended().CopyTo(mBuffer + mLength, Mac::ExtAddress::kReverseByteOrder); in AppendMacAddress()
113 SuccessOrExit(error = aMessage.Read(aOffset, mBuffer + mLength, aLength)); in AppendBytesFromMessage()
126 buffer = &mBuffer[mLength]; in AppendLength()
135 memcpy(mBuffer + aOffset, aBuffer, aLength); in WriteBytes()
146 memmove(mBuffer + aOffset + aLength, mBuffer + aOffset, mLength - aOffset); in InsertBytes()
147 memcpy(mBuffer + aOffset, aBuffer, aLength); in InsertBytes()
156 memmove(mBuffer + aOffset, mBuffer + aOffset + aLength, mLength - aOffset - aLength); in RemoveBytes()
Ddata.hpp123 mBuffer = static_cast<const uint8_t *>(aBuffer); in Init()
159 const uint8_t *GetBytes(void) const { return mBuffer; } in GetBytes()
182 void CopyBytesTo(void *aBuffer) const { memcpy(aBuffer, mBuffer, mLength); } in CopyBytesTo()
194 … bool MatchesBytesIn(const void *aBuffer) const { return memcmp(mBuffer, aBuffer, mLength) == 0; } in MatchesBytesIn()
209 return MatchBytes(mBuffer, static_cast<const uint8_t *>(aBuffer), mLength, aMatcher); in MatchesBytesIn()
222 return (mLength == aOtherData.mLength) && MatchesBytesIn(aOtherData.mBuffer); in operator ==()
238 return (mLength >= aOtherData.mLength) && aOtherData.MatchesBytesIn(mBuffer); in StartsWith()
242 const uint8_t *mBuffer; member in ot::Data
260 using Base::mBuffer;
340 memcpy(AsNonConst(mBuffer), aBuffer, mLength); in CopyBytesFrom()
Dstring.hpp469 void ConvertToLowercase(void) { StringConvertToLowercase(mBuffer); } in ConvertToLowercase()
474 void ConvertToUppercase(void) { StringConvertToUppercase(mBuffer); } in ConvertToUppercase()
477 char *mBuffer; member in ot::StringWriter
494 : StringWriter(mBuffer, sizeof(mBuffer)) in String()
503 const char *AsCString(void) const { return mBuffer; } in AsCString()
506 char mBuffer[kSize]; member in ot::String
Dstring.cpp309 : mBuffer(aBuffer) in StringWriter()
313 mBuffer[0] = kNullChar; in StringWriter()
318 mBuffer[0] = kNullChar; in Clear()
337 len = vsnprintf(mBuffer + mLength, (mSize > mLength ? (mSize - mLength) : 0), aFormat, aArgs); in AppendVarArgs()
344 mBuffer[mSize - 1] = kNullChar; in AppendVarArgs()
Dmessage.hpp245 Metadata &GetMetadata(void) { return mBuffer.mHead.mMetadata; } in GetMetadata()
246 const Metadata &GetMetadata(void) const { return mBuffer.mHead.mMetadata; } in GetMetadata()
248 uint8_t *GetFirstData(void) { return mBuffer.mHead.mData; } in GetFirstData()
249 const uint8_t *GetFirstData(void) const { return mBuffer.mHead.mData; } in GetFirstData()
251 uint8_t *GetData(void) { return mBuffer.mData; } in GetData()
252 const uint8_t *GetData(void) const { return mBuffer.mData; } in GetData()
263 } mBuffer; member in ot::Buffer
1519 const Buffer *GetBuffer(void) const { return mBuffer; } in GetBuffer()
1520 void SetBuffer(const Buffer *aBuffer) { mBuffer = aBuffer; } in SetBuffer()
1523 const Buffer *mBuffer; // Buffer containing the chunk member in ot::Message::Chunk
Dframe_builder.hpp67 const uint8_t *GetBytes(void) const { return mBuffer; } in GetBytes()
325 uint8_t *mBuffer; member in ot::FrameBuilder
Dmessage.cpp429 if (GetReserved() < sizeof(mBuffer.mHead.mData)) in PrependBytes()
432 … memcpy(newBuffer->mBuffer.mHead.mData + GetReserved(), mBuffer.mHead.mData + GetReserved(), in PrependBytes()
433 sizeof(mBuffer.mHead.mData) - GetReserved()); in PrependBytes()
/openthread-latest/src/posix/platform/
Dip6_utils.hpp113 …VerifyOrDie(inet_ntop(AF_INET6, aAddress, mBuffer, sizeof(mBuffer)) != nullptr, OT_EXIT_ERROR_ERRN… in Ip6AddressString()
121 const char *AsCString(void) const { return mBuffer; } in AsCString()
124 char mBuffer[INET6_ADDRSTRLEN]; member in ot::Posix::Ip6Utils::Ip6AddressString
Dtrel.cpp61 uint8_t mBuffer[kMaxPacketSize]; member
322 …if (SendPacket(packet->mBuffer, packet->mLength, &packet->mDestSockAddr) == OT_ERROR_INVALID_STATE) in SendQueuedPackets()
358 memcpy(packet->mBuffer, aBuffer, aLength); in EnqueuePacket()
Dinfra_if.cpp547 uint8_t mBuffer[kMaxNetLinkBufSize]; in ReceiveNetLinkMessage() member
550 len = recv(mNetLinkSocket, msgBuffer.mBuffer, sizeof(msgBuffer.mBuffer), 0); in ReceiveNetLinkMessage()
/openthread-latest/src/core/crypto/
Dstorage.cpp80 mKey = mBuffer; in LiteralKey()
81 mLength = sizeof(mBuffer); in LiteralKey()
82 SuccessOrAssert(aKey.ExtractKey(mBuffer, mLength)); in LiteralKey()
Dstorage.hpp383 uint8_t mBuffer[kMaxSize]; member in ot::Crypto::LiteralKey
/openthread-latest/tests/unit/
Dtest_multipan_rcp_instances.cpp226 , mBuffer(mBuf, kTestBufferSize) in TestHost()
227 , mEncoder(mBuffer) in TestHost()
344 size_t frame_len = mBuffer.OutFrameGetLength(); in sendToRcp()
351 SuccessOrQuit(mBuffer.OutFrameRemove()); in sendToRcp()
374 Spinel::Buffer mBuffer; member in TestHost